Shorts usually get out after a price decline since they're death spirals and buy from the company at a discount to the low prices.
They tend to increase during a price rise as they make a lot more profit on those death spiral shares.
PNTV's short seem to follow that trend, though there aren't very many short shares. They cover quickly from the company. I expect you'll see a decrease at the next period report as it was declining time and an increase during the current period - at least if the price stays well above 2 cents for more than another day or two.
